Have you ever been frustrated by the actions of your city council? Are you dissatisfied with the direction your local schools are going? Have you ever considered running for local office?
Many of the decisions that affect our daily lives are made by local government officials. In many ways, it is just as important to have good local political leaders as it is having good Congressmen.

Right now, all eyes are on the November election and for good reason. However, the next municipal election is scheduled for April 2011. Petitions have to be filed for many of these local offices by November 22nd. It’s unfortunate that in Illinois politics never sleep, but we have to find good candidates for these local offices now. More importantly, we need to find those good people who would run but are reluctant due to a lack of resources.

The Illinois Local Government Project is a resource designed to assist concerned taxpayers in running for local offices such as city councils, school boards, park boards and township offices. Many times, concerned taxpayers want to run for office and make a difference but find little help in actually making a campaign happen.

The effort will equip interested candidates with key guidance in the petitioning process to get on the ballot, guidance in how to campaign, assistance with messaging, and connections to other service providers and potentially donors.
